About GPON
Gigabit Passive Optical Network with 2.488 Gbps downstream and 1.244Gbps Upstream
Passive Optical Power splitters used to share a single fiber with 32/64/128 ONTs/ONU
Dominant technology for delivering last kms access over fiber
International Standards Based Protocol ITU-T G.984.x and G.988 specified protocol developed by FSAN (Full Service Access Network) and interoperability by Broadband Forum (BBF)
G-PON use has been extended beyond providing FTTx Broadband Access to applications such as 2G/3G/LTE/WiMAX Mobile Backhaul (MBH) and Fiber to the Desktop
G-PON Dual IPv4 and IPv6 Stack support defined in G.988© 2012 3

G-PON for Railway SectorBroadband Railway Line (BRL) Networks
Example – RailTel Corporation’s Backbone DWDM Network
10
RailTel Corporation of India Limited, a Government of India undertaking under the Ministry of Railways, has built a state of the art backbone network of SDH & DWDM:
600 Cities 3,400 towns and village
stations 40,000 RKM (Routed km)
Present DWDM Network using STM-16 (2.488Gbps) 10,500 RKM
31 Points-of-Presence (PoPs) 100G which can be augmented
to 400/800G capacity 14,000 RKM planned in 2012
across additional 44 cities to cover whole of India
Network ready to deliver 10G
Source: “Building Futuristic Network for Indian Railways Signaling & Administrative Application,ANSHUL GUPTA, ED/CC. RailTelALOK AGINIHOTRI, Manager/Marketing, RailTel. IRSTE Quarterly Journal January-March,2012

BRL Network “Two-spoke” G-PON ODN Topology
© 2012 16
OLT is the hub of the virtual wheel. The trunk/feeder fibre is indicated by the solid red lines, the spokes, of which the fibre spurs off to the Primary Fibre Concentration Point (FCP).
ONT/ONUs grouped in clusters consisting of one or more zones, with each zone containing the Secondary Fibre Concentration Point (FCP).
“Two-spoke” a good candidate for using Linear Bus Splitter topology“Two-spoke” a good candidate for using Linear Bus Splitter topology

G-PON for Fiber to the Panchayat
National Telecom Policy-2011 (NTP-2011)
© 2012 19
Currently: 12.35M broadband connections
Targets: 175M by 2017 600M by 2020
Fiber-to-the-Panchayat Program to cover 600,000 villages
Promoting Local R&D, Manufacturing
G-PON for Fiber-to-the-Panchayat in India (Rural Broadband)
© 2012 20
250,000 Panchayats and 600,000 villages to be connected by GPON
Nation’s first Broadband center in Sarwan was inaugurated by MP Hon. Rahul Gandhi and Chairman of Innovation Council, Sam Pitroda
Partially funded by Universal Services Obligations (USO) fund

G-PON for Education SectorCampus Networks (IIT KGP)
G-PON for IIT KGP Campus Deployment
All campus locations covering 30,000 people and over 2,000 acres
Triple/Quadruple play Connectivity to Hostels and Various Departments / Residential Quarters
Used for delivering IPTV, VoD, Internet, Voice, Courseware, E-learning
Connected to National Knowledge Network Inaugurated by Prime Minister of India

Conclusion
Conclusion
G-PON’s passive, built-in traffic aggregation, seamless integration into existing fibre plants, huge user capacity, service oriented FCAPS, Advanced Security support, High Availability options such a path protection, and flexible ODN topology such a linear add/drop bus, makes it a perfect match for building Optical Broadband Railway Line (BRL) Access Networks
As Railway’s deploy G-PON for the Access and Edge Aggregation portion of their Optical Fibre communication (OFC) networks, it is expected that as of yet un-envisioned Railway-specific new revenue generating services and applications will be realizable due to G-PON’s any-play service architecture.
